Day 8 – Friday

Tonsillectomy Recovery & Adenoidectomy Surgery

It just turned over to midnight, I felt something funny like and more bad tasting in my mouth. I spit out blood. I went to go look at my throat and it looks like one of the scabs may have came off. I can see the bleeding. My left side. My right side scab is still there. It has a different feel to that side. I do not think all of it came off, but I know some of it did. Once you start bleeding, you have to keep on eye on it. Too much bleeding you can hemorrhage.That area where I believe it may have come off now feels like a throbbing feeling.

The bleeding on my first one stopped a short time after. I kept rinsing my mouth with water. I believe that might have helped.

I did wake up chilled and sore. I slept almost five hours, most at one time. But, I woke up dry mouth. I took my body temp it said 96.1. Lower than normal.

Made scrambled eggs to try to eat, kind hard to eat the eggs. One their too warm (something you rarely ever here me say, I’m picky as my hot food just be hot). It still hurts to swallow for two. (Guess that’s why they say cold soft foods for two weeks. One week down on that and one to go) again, not to over do it, I ate small and tiny bites.

I’m tired of soft cold foods I want real food. Mashed potatoes I tried to make other day was hard to eat as they stick in your mouth. Eggs might work if you like wet & cold eggs.

I started to feel emotion yesterday night and today I felt really emotion.

The pain seemed to come back. I know the pain has came and gone. Some times are more tolerable than others.
